Magnum LTL Celebrates 10 Years | |
Congratulations and thank you to Jamie Stewart, Mark Herman, and Dan Kummrow of Magnum on 10 years of membership! Magnum is a family-owned asset-based logistics company established in 1978 to provide supply chain network solutions. Magnum is comprised of five separately incorporated divisions geared towards meeting the specific needs of its customers; Magnum LTD, Magnum LTL (Willmar terminal), Magnum Dedicated, Magnum Warehousing, and Magnum Logistics. Headquartered in Fargo, Magnum services a variety of industries throughout the United States.

Bolton & Menk at Zero Hour | |
The Business Education Network and the Willmar Senior High welcomed Bolton & Menk on October 23rd. Students showed off their engineering skills by building spaghetti towers that could hold a marshmallow. Lots of great tips and creativity were shown as the students worked on their towers.
Zero Hour is the first hour on Wednesdays at Willmar High School scheduled every other week for students to catch up on tests or missing work. Those that do not have work to catch up on are in the commons area until classes start at 9am. This provides the opportunity to showcase all the fantastic businesses in the Willmar Lakes Area.
